University of Oregon’s One-Stop-Shop for Athlete Data

  • On July 20, 2018

Earlier this year at the 2018 MIT Sloan Sports and Analytics Conference, Andrew Murray, Director of Performance and Sports Science from the University of Oregon, shared in a number of sessions presenting on how the University aggregate information and data streams from numerous technologies and other sources to make better informed decisions on athlete health, well-being and performance.

 

 

 

 

 

 

Andrew Murray presenting on behalf of Fusion Sport at the 2018 MIT Sloan Sports and Analytics Conference in Chicago.

 

Logan Bradley from SportTechie sat down with Andrew Murray to discuss the implementation of SMARTABASE athlete management software at the University of Oregon and how it’s a one-stop shop for driving human peformance.
